Pimpinella anisum

75 days

Anise is an attractive, fine-textured herb grown for its licorice-scented leaves and delicately flavored seeds. The sweet tasting leaves are used in salads, with cooked vegetables, and as a garnish. Add the aromatic seeds to fruit salads and sauces, soups and baked goods.

  • lacy leaves and a profusion of white flowers 
  • The flavor of aniseed resembles that of licorice.
  • requires a fairly alkaline soil pH of 6.3 to 7.0 and needs full sun and well-drained soil.
  • grows just under 2 feet tall, requires a warm growing season of at least 120 days.
  • harvested in August to September when the flowers go to seed.

☼ Full sun. Annual. Plant grows 24-30”/60-75cm tall.
